(REUTEBB TELEGRAMS.) London, February 10. It is currently reported here to-day that Gordon was stabbed while fighting was proceeding, before the capture of Khartoum, and that he subsequently died of his wounds. It is stated that fully one-fourth of Gordon's adherents were massacred by Mahdites. Amongst the latter's victims were a number of women and children. It is announced that 10,000 men of the Army Reserve will shortly be called out for the garrison duty in Great Britain. Suakim, February 10. News has reached here that Osman Digna is massing a large force of Mahdiites near Tamai, between this place and Berber. Bombay, February 10. The reinforcements of troops to be despatched to the Soudan from India will consist of the Indian native regiments.
